24 January 2008

He has a gift

Captain Codpiece's ever so brief visit to Egypt during his recent Legacy 08 Tour has served to worsen relations between Washington and Cairo. Can someone help me? I can't think of anything that he has touched, at least recently, that hasn't turned into a complete pile of shite. Is there anything I've forgotten?

